Output 54d891a7dd7373e865d28f12c76462bdcb53c108b1ac27edd0d63a7a652b4161:1

value
1070792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2655758f97491edfd8da639482d9e769fe17460e OP_EQUAL
address
35BhyeKEzNdfVmhZhbPrufuCif1rwXDqjf
transaction
54d891a7dd7373e865d28f12c76462bdcb53c108b1ac27edd0d63a7a652b4161
spent
true